Local Entrepreneur Bryan Eisenberg Shines as Finalist in Round Rock Business Awards

Recognized for Leadership and Innovation in Senior Care

Round Rock, Texas – Bryan Eisenberg, co-owner of A Place At Home – North Austin, has made waves in the local business community by being named a finalist in three significant categories for the Round Rock Chamber’s 2026 Annual Business Awards. These awards are an excellent showcase of the remarkable contributions made by businesses and leaders within the Round Rock community.

The awards highlight the resilience and innovative spirit of local entrepreneurs, emphasizing the role of limited regulation in allowing small businesses to flourish. With Austin’s economy steadily growing, initiatives such as these awards acknowledge the hard work and dedication of individuals like Eisenberg, who are committed to improving their communities through entrepreneurial endeavors.

Finalist Categories

  • Ambassador of the Year
  • Entrepreneur of the Year
  • Investor of the Year

About A Place At Home – North Austin

A Place At Home – North Austin is a key player in offering compassionate in-home care, senior living alternatives, and family support services across Austin, Round Rock, Georgetown, Cedar Park, Hutto, Pflugerville, and the surrounding areas. The organization stands out for its commitment to providing dignified care to seniors and their families, enabling them to lead fulfilling lives. Remarkably, they are also VA-credentialed, ensuring high-quality care services specifically catered to veterans.

About the Round Rock Chamber’s Annual Business Awards

Now in its 58th year, the Chamber’s Annual Business Awards serve as Round Rock’s premier business event, attracting approximately 600-800 attendees annually. This year’s banquet is set for February 5, 2026, at Kalahari Resorts & Conventions, providing an excellent opportunity to network and recognize local achievements in business.

Recent Recognition

Further demonstrating its outstanding service, A Place At Home – North Austin was also nominated for the 2025 Best of Round Rock award in the Senior Care Services category. This recognition follows their prior win in 2024, reflecting the growing appreciation of their commitment to excellence within the community.

About Bryan Eisenberg

Bryan Eisenberg brings a wealth of experience to his role as co-owner of A Place At Home – North Austin. A former social worker and serial entrepreneur, he collaborates with his wife, Stacey Eisenberg, who boasts over 40 years of expertise in senior care. Together, they prioritize compassionate, personalized care that helps seniors thrive while remaining in the comfort of their own homes.
